Dark & Stormy 2011

November 4th - 6th

It’s almost here!

The Dark & Stormy Beach Weekend November 4-6 in Manzanita offers fun activities and discounts for everyone.

“What’s there to do on a Dark & Stormy Weekend at the Beach?” Plenty!

The second Dark and Stormy weekend in Manzanita offers events and activities for all ages.

Books of course are central to winter on the coast. Join your fellow writers and book lovers 7 pm Saturday November 5 to hear New York Times Bestselling author Chelsea Cain read from her new book The Night Season. Dubbed the “Queen of serial-killer fiction” by Kirkus Reviews, Cain sets her latest book in Portland, (very appropriately for us), during a massive storm and flooding. Find out more about why she writes thrillers here.  Her reading will be followed by our popular Open Mic focused on the theme of “It was a dark and stormy night” at the Hoffman Center in Manzanita.
